BHOPAL : West-Central Railway General Manager Ramesh Chandra, on Thursday, took stock of the preparations being made at Bhopal railway station in the light of ‘Simhastha Kumbh Mela-2016’. He surveyed the work of laying of second line from Nishatpura Yard to Bairagarh station. Chandra also inspected Bairagarh station and discussed the possibility of opening a second entry with the officials.
Chandra instructed the officials at Bhopal station to ensure cleanliness and maintenance of drainage system. He inspected the facilities like foot over-bridge, waiting rooms, retiring rooms, reservation office, platforms and circulating areas. He discussed on construction of shade over Platform number one and foot over-bridge.
